ABSTRACT

BACKGROUND: The Scottish RD Survey reported an incidence of 12.05/100,000/yr in 2009. Data published from Denmark recently confirmed a 50% increase in RD presentations over the last 16 years. We set out to repeat the Scottish RD survey to determine if a similar trend has been observed in Scotland. METHODS: All 16 Scottish VR surgeons, who make up the collaboration of Scottish VR Surgeons (SCVRs) were asked to prospectively record all primary RDs presenting from 12th August 2019 to 11th August 2020. For consistency, the case definitions were the same as for the 2009 Scottish RD Survey. Basic demographic and clinical features were recorded. Age specific incidence was calculated from mid-year population estimates for 2019 obtained from the National Records of Scotland. RESULTS: There were 875 RRDs recorded, which gives an updated incidence of 16.02/100,000/year in Scotland. 62.8% occurred in males and the greatest increases were seen in males aged 50-59 (p = 0.0094), 60-69 (p = 0.0395) and females aged 40-49 (p = 0.0312) and 50-59 (p = 0.0024). The proportion of pseudophakic RRDs in this study is 29.4% (253/860). Compared to the 21.6% in the 2010 study, this represents a 28% increase (χ2 = 11.03, p = 0.0009). The proportion of macula-off RRDs remained generally stable at 58%. CONCLUSION: Our study confirms that RRD is becoming more common in the UK, reflecting almost identical findings from Denmark. This trend is in part due to increasing myopia, increasing pseudophakia, and possibly other factors. This should be considered when planning VR services and allocating resources in the future.

ABSTRACT

INTRODUCTION: Since 2010, General Ophthalmic Services (GOS) legislation and Independent Prescribing (IP) enable community optometrists to manage primary eye conditions. No studies have assessed the effect of IP. We wished to determine the distribution of IP optometrists and associated hospital referral rates across Scotland. METHODS: In 2019, FOI requests (General Optical Council and NHS Education Scotland) identified all registered IP optometrists in Scotland and their registered postcodes. Data regarding community eye examinations and referrals to HES since 2010 were gathered via Information Services Division of NHS Scotland. RESULTS: As of March 2019, there were 278 IP optometrists in Scotland (278/1189; 23.4%). Two hundred eighteen IP optometrists work in 293 practices across 11 of Scotland's 14 health boards. There was a strong correlation (r = +0.96) between population density and number of IP optometrists. Fifty-six percent of IP optometrists work in the two most deprived quintiles. Since IP's introduction, there has been a marked increase in anterior segment supplementary visits (+290%). Optometry referrals to GPs have reduced by 10.5%, but referrals to HES have increased by 118% (to 96,315). There was no correlation between quantity of IP optometrists and referral rates to HES (r = -0.06, 95% CI -0.64 to 0.56, p = 0.86). CONCLUSIONS: This is the first analysis of IP optometrists and associated referral rates in Scotland. Despite good geographical distribution and increased supplementary attendances, optometric referrals to HES have doubled and continue to rise. We propose a ratio of primary, supplementary, non-referral and referral rates to discern the true impact of IP versus non-IP community optometric behaviour.

ABSTRACT

BACKGROUND: Aflibercept is widely used as a treatment for neovascular age-related macular degeneration (nAMD). Nevertheless, there is no consensus in the optimal injection frequency in the 2nd year of treatment along with little real-world data on visual outcomes. On that basis, the primary aim of this study was to assess the visual acuity (VA) and the total number of injections needed on average for these patients during the 24-month follow-up. MATERIALS AND METHODS: This is a retrospective observational study from an electronic medical record of consecutive patients treated with intravitreal aflibercept (both naïve and nonnaïve eyes) who had completed the 24-month follow-up since the commencement of treatment. Patients followed the VIEW protocol in year 1 whereas in year 2, an as required approach/Pro Re Nata (PRN) was used. RESULTS: Eighty-seven eyes of 78 patients were analyzed. 43.7% were nonnaive eyes. Baseline VA for all eyes (logMAR) was 52.6 letters, improving to 56.2 letters at 12 months and 55 at 24 months. Almost 83.9% of the treated eyes (81.3% of the patients) did not experience any significant visual loss receiving on average of 9.9 injections in the 24 months of follow-up and attending the hospital eye service 20.3 times in total. CONCLUSIONS: Aflibercept as monotherapy for the treatment of nAMD is associated with good 2 nd year outcomes in a real-world setting using the PRN approach in year 2 and fewer injections comparing to the clinical studies, but a higher proportion of follow-up visits compared to the treat and extend regimen.

ABSTRACT

Oculopharyngeal Muscular Dystrophy (OPMD) is a systemic progressive autosomal dominant myopathy which results in ptosis due to levator weakness. Surgical correction can be complicated by corneal exposure and a non-surgical alternative, such as ptosis props, can be uncomfortable in patients with preserved orbicularis function. We describe a case of a 57-year-old gentleman with OPMD, who declined surgical intervention, and self-manages his ptosis with cosmetic glue.

ABSTRACT

INTRODUCTION: Although the worldwide prevalence of disseminated candidaemia is rising, reported intraocular candidiasis rates are variable, even as low as 1%. The Infectious Diseases Society of America recommends fundoscopy screening for all fungal blood culture positive patients. We wished to evaluate the impact of this recommendation on our department. METHODS: A retrospective observational study was performed in NHS Greater Glasgow and Clyde (population = 1.15 million) for all patients with candida positive blood culture results over a 2-year period. RESULTS: From January 2015 to December 2016, 258 candida positive cultures were obtained from 168 adults (mean age = 62 years, range: 17-94 years; 85 females, 83 males). Candida species were isolated in 161/168 (95.8%) cases (43.5% Candida albicans, 35.7% Candida glabrata). All 168 cases were treated with intravenous antifungals. 84 patients (50%) were formally referred to ophthalmology. Of those not referred, 21 were deceased prior to culture result (12.5%) and 14 patients subsequently deteriorated (8.3%). Six patients reported visual symptoms. In total, 65% had no ocular findings and 32.5% had unrelated ocular signs. Only one patient had signs consistent with Candida chorioretinitis, making the prevalence of intraocular candida in our population 1.3% (1/80). CONCLUSIONS: The prevalence of ocular candidiasis is low, presumably due to potent systemic antifungal agents and good intraocular penetration. Our findings support the view that routine fundoscopy screening may not be indicated in every culture positive patient. This paper provides an evidence base for the Royal College's Eyecare in intensive care unit recommendations regarding targeted screening of non-verbal, symptomatic or high-risk patients.
